Understanding the Unique Aspects of the Luxury Market

The luxury home market isn't simply a higher-priced segment of the broader real estate landscape. It operates under its own set of rules and considerations. Properties often boast bespoke features, expansive acreage, prime locations, and a clientele with specific, often demanding, requirements. Therefore, a comprehensive understanding of these nuances is crucial for success.

What sets luxury homes apart?

Luxury homes transcend the definition of a "nice" house. They represent a lifestyle, embodying exclusivity, high-end finishes, and unparalleled amenities. These might include private pools, sprawling gardens, smart-home technology integration, chef's kitchens, wine cellars, home theaters, guest houses, and unique architectural designs. Location is paramount, often situated in exclusive neighborhoods or boasting breathtaking views.

How is the luxury market different from the general market?

The luxury market exhibits distinct characteristics compared to the broader real estate market. Inventory is typically lower, resulting in less competition for buyers but more discerning sellers. Transaction times can be longer, reflecting the thorough due diligence and negotiation processes involved. Pricing strategies necessitate a deep understanding of comparable sales (comps) and market trends within specific luxury enclaves. Moreover, financing options for ultra-high-net-worth individuals often deviate from standard mortgage procedures.

Finding the Right Luxury Real Estate Agent

Selecting the right real estate agent is paramount in the luxury market. It's more than just finding someone who holds a license; you need an expert who possesses specialized knowledge, experience, and a proven track record within the high-end sector.

What qualities should I look for in a luxury real estate agent?

Your agent should have extensive experience in the luxury market, a strong network of high-net-worth individuals and connections to relevant professionals (e.g., architects, interior designers, financial advisors), deep market knowledge of your target area, exceptional negotiation skills, and a discreet and professional demeanor. Look for someone who understands your unique needs and can provide personalized service.

How can I find a reputable luxury real estate agent?

Start by seeking recommendations from trusted sources within your network. Research agents online, reviewing their client testimonials and examining their portfolio of past sales. Attend luxury real estate events or open houses to network and meet potential agents. Look for an agent who actively engages in professional development within the luxury real estate field.

The Importance of Due Diligence in Luxury Home Purchases

Due diligence is even more critical in the luxury market, given the higher financial stakes and the potential for complexities related to property features, legal issues, and historical data.

What are the key due diligence steps for luxury home buyers?

Thorough inspections are crucial, ideally performed by specialists in high-end properties. Review all legal documentation meticulously, including surveys, title reports, and environmental assessments. Investigate property taxes, homeowner association regulations, and any potential future development impacts in the area. Don't hesitate to engage specialized professionals (e.g., structural engineers, environmental consultants) for expert advice.

How can I ensure a smooth closing process?

Working with a skilled attorney specializing in real estate law is highly recommended. Clear communication with your agent, lender, and legal team throughout the process is vital. Ensure all documentation is reviewed thoroughly and that all contingencies are addressed before closing.

Marketing Your Luxury Home Effectively

Selling a luxury home requires a strategic marketing approach that goes beyond standard real estate listings. Highlighting the unique features and lifestyle aspects of the property is key to attracting high-net-worth buyers.

What are the best marketing strategies for luxury homes?

High-quality photography and videography are paramount, ideally showcasing the property's architectural details and surrounding landscape. Consider using virtual tours and drone footage to provide potential buyers with an immersive experience. Leverage your agent's network and explore partnerships with luxury lifestyle publications or websites. Target marketing through specialized channels that reach high-net-worth individuals is essential.

How can I maximize the value of my luxury property?

Before listing, consider staging your home professionally to highlight its luxurious aspects. Make necessary repairs and upgrades that enhance the property's appeal and value. Price strategically based on thorough market research and competitive analysis.
